Merge lp://qastaging/~bladernr/checkbox-certification/remove-most-jobs-and-scripts into lp://qastaging/checkbox-certification

Proposed by Jeff Lane 
Status: Rejected
Rejected by: Marc Tardif
Proposed branch: lp://qastaging/~bladernr/checkbox-certification/remove-most-jobs-and-scripts
Merge into: lp://qastaging/checkbox-certification
Diff against target: 3018 lines (+10/-2781)
44 files modified
debian/changelog (+9/-0)
jobs/audio.txt (+0/-10)
jobs/certification.txt (+1/-1)
jobs/codecs.txt (+0/-25)
jobs/cpu.txt (+0/-39)
jobs/daemons.txt (+0/-67)
jobs/disk.txt (+0/-65)
jobs/evolution.txt (+0/-26)
jobs/floppy.txt (+0/-13)
jobs/gcalctool.txt (+0/-52)
jobs/gedit.txt (+0/-22)
jobs/gnome-terminal.txt (+0/-12)
jobs/hardware.txt (+0/-31)
jobs/install.txt (+0/-7)
jobs/kernel.txt (+0/-14)
jobs/lid.txt (+0/-29)
jobs/mago.txt (+0/-8)
jobs/media.txt (+0/-25)
jobs/netio.txt (+0/-16)
jobs/panel_clock_test.txt (+0/-24)
jobs/panel_reboot.txt (+0/-10)
jobs/unity.txt (+0/-19)
jobs/xorg.txt (+0/-18)
scripts/audio_detect_silence (+0/-42)
scripts/check_unity (+0/-20)
scripts/cking_suite (+0/-103)
scripts/clocktest.c (+0/-124)
scripts/cpu_offlining (+0/-30)
scripts/cpu_topology (+0/-86)
scripts/disk_read_performance_test (+0/-39)
scripts/disk_smart (+0/-205)
scripts/floppy_test (+0/-93)
scripts/fwts_test (+0/-92)
scripts/ipmi_test (+0/-32)
scripts/mago_filter (+0/-98)
scripts/mago_suite (+0/-96)
scripts/max_diskspace_used (+0/-19)
scripts/network_bandwidth_test (+0/-674)
scripts/network_info (+0/-49)
scripts/network_wireless_test (+0/-25)
scripts/process_wait (+0/-70)
scripts/storage_test (+0/-53)
scripts/watch_command (+0/-159)
scripts/xorg_memory_test (+0/-139)
To merge this branch: bzr merge lp://qastaging/~bladernr/checkbox-certification/remove-most-jobs-and-scripts
Reviewer Review Type Date Requested Status
Marc Tardif (community) Disapprove
Review via email: mp+58620@code.qastaging.launchpad.net

Description of the change

Round two of Operation Kill Checkbox-Certification has commenced. This request is for a new -certification branch that has had most of the job and script files moved out to -certification. there are only a handfull left, and after most all of those are gone, I'll try to start working on the underlying code (plugins, etc) that may need to be merged into -compat to make everything work properly.

The remaining jobs/scripts will need a bit of merging with existing job or script files in -compat that have the same name.

After moving all these job files and scripts in, I built the packages locally and tested them with a full certification run, and all the scripts and tests seemed to function. The only failures were due to unmet dependencies like dt and bonnie++ as I installed my packages straight with dpkg rather than some other means.

It is important that this merge request is tied directly in with the checkbox-compatibility merge request just submitted.

To post a comment you must log in.
Revision history for this message
Marc Tardif (cr3) wrote :

Replaced as part of story 243.

review: Disapprove

Unmerged revisions

375. By Jeff Lane 

updated the changelog and incremented the version because this is a fairly large change to the code base.

374. By Jeff Lane 

moved most of the job files and scripts to -compat

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
The diff is not available at this time. You can reload the page or download it.

Subscribers

People subscribed via source and target branches